## Decision facts: opencode-swarm

- **Pricing:** freemium - Open-source project under MIT license is available freely; support services or advanced features might come with a cost not detailed.
- **Requirements:** Requires Bun for installation and configuration.; Installation automatically configures project settings, adjusts plugins, and overrides certain native agent functions to avoid conflicts.
- **Adopt for:** Opencode-Swarm is an architect-centric AI-driven development tool built with TypeScript that leverages an agent-swarm architecture to streamline code generation and quality assurance.
- **License detail:** MIT license allows for free use, modification, and distribution of the software.

## When NOT to use opencode-swarm

- If your workflow requires continuous real-time human oversight of individual agent operations, since Opencode-Swarm automates and reduces routing conflicts by disabling native agents.
- For teams unwilling to adopt new configuration files like `.opencode/opencode-swarm.json` that require specific project-level overrides setup.
